func calcCountFromTPS(tps int64, now int64) int {
if tps == 0 {
return 0
}
if tps < 0 {
panic("clock: tps must >= 0")
}
diff := now - lastSystemTime
2018-01-07 12:32:18 +01:00
if diff < 0 {
2017-08-05 17:52:12 +02:00
return 0
}
count := 0
2018-01-07 08:43:01 +01:00
syncWithSystemClock := false
// Detect whether the previous time is too old.
2021-04-24 16:24:11 +02:00
// Use either 5 ticks or 5/60 sec in the case when TPS is too big like 300 (#1444).
if diff > max(int64(time.Second)*5/tps, int64(time.Second)*5/60) || prevTPS != tps {
// The previous time is too old.
// Let's force to sync the game time with the system clock.
2018-01-07 08:43:01 +01:00
syncWithSystemClock = true
} else {
count = int(diff * tps / int64(time.Second))
}
prevTPS = tps
2020-10-17 09:08:41 +02:00
// Stabilize the count.
2018-01-07 12:32:18 +01:00
// Without this adjustment, count can be unstable like 0, 2, 0, 2, ...
2020-12-20 13:58:43 +01:00
// TODO: Brush up this logic so that this will work with any FPS. Now this works only when FPS = TPS.
if count == 0 && (int64(time.Second)/tps/2) < diff {
count = 1
}
if count == 2 && (int64(time.Second)/tps*3/2) > diff {
count = 1
}
2018-01-07 08:43:01 +01:00
if syncWithSystemClock {
lastSystemTime = now
2017-08-05 17:52:12 +02:00
} else {
lastSystemTime += int64(count) * int64(time.Second) / tps
2017-08-05 17:52:12 +02:00
}
return count
2017-07-13 17:28:28 +02:00
}

// UpdateFrame updates the inner clock state and returns an integer value
// indicating how many times the game should update based on the current tps.
//
2022-07-12 06:18:30 +02:00
// If tps is SyncWithFPS, UpdateFrame always returns 1.
// If tps <= 0 and not SyncWithFPS, UpdateFrame always returns 0.
//
2022-07-12 06:18:30 +02:00
// UpdateFrame is expected to be called once per frame.
func UpdateFrame() int {
m.Lock()
defer m.Unlock()
n := now()
if lastNow > n {
// This ensures that now() must be monotonic (#875).
panic("clock: lastNow must be older than n")
}
lastNow = n
2019-05-08 19:44:14 +02:00
2018-07-17 19:11:00 +02:00
c := 0
if tps == SyncWithFPS {
2018-07-17 19:11:00 +02:00
c = 1
} else if tps > 0 {
c = calcCountFromTPS(int64(tps), n)
}
2018-07-17 19:11:00 +02:00
updateFPSAndTPS(n, c)
2019-05-08 19:44:14 +02:00
2018-07-17 19:11:00 +02:00
return c
}
